A Moment with Malidoma - From RITUAL: Power, Healing and Community

"Where ritual is absent, the young ones are restless or violent, there are no real elders,
 and the grown-ups are bewildered. The future is dim."

"We owe to the cosmic order because we are individually and communally responsible for its maintenance.

Every person is sent to this outpost called Earth to work on a project that is intended to keep this cosmic order healthy. Any person that fails to do what he or she must do energetically stains the cosmic order."

"...when the focus of everyday living displaces ritual in a given society, social decay begins to work from the inside out."

"...the weakening of links with the spirit world, and general alienation of people from themselves and others.

"In a content like this there are no elders to help anyone remember through initiation of his or her important  place in the community."

"...throwing away one's culture for another is an insult to the dead, and can result, as in the case of Africa, in a lot of unresolved ills."
  
"...hiddenness is effectiveness. Hiddenness is power."
  
"To be attracted to an ancient way of life is initiate one's personal spiritual emancipation."

"...the expression of emotion as a process of self-rekindling or calming, which not only helps in handling death, but also resets or repairs the feelings within the person."
